I need to know details of Bank Of India, Clerk post salary offer with other information so that you can get idea. Job Profile This is the starting point for educated youth in the banks. Usually newly recruited bank staff is given training for few weeks and then they are placed either in a branch or an administrative office. At the branch, clerical staff is supposed to work as Front Office person and has direct interaction with the public. However, with most of the banks being fully computerized, the job profile will be related to working on computers and entering the day to day transactions in the system. Tentative dates Facilities Places with Population > 45 lakhs Below 45 Lakhs Basic Pay Rs.11765/- Rs.11765/- Special Allowance Rs.911.79/- Rs.911.79/- DA Rs.5311.58/- Rs.5311.58/- CCA Rs. 0/- Rs. 0/- Transport Allowance Rs.425/- Rs.425/- Total (without HRA) Rs.18413.37/- Rs.18413.37/- HRA Rs.1176.5/- Rs.1058.85/- Gross with HRA Rs.19589.87/- Rs.19472.22/- Perks Leased Accommodation: Those, who are appointed as clerk through IBPS, will be admissible for Leased Accommodation from recruiting banks. Traveling Allowance: Some banks also offer Traveling Allowance to the Clerks. These allowances are based on the distance between the work place and home. Medical Aid: All banks pay Medical Allowances to the Clerks per year. It is around Rs. 2000/- per year and for serious issue, employees can also get other medical benefits. |
